Gwynedd Valley, PA – Marywood University's volleyball team won its fourth straight match, defeating host Gwynedd-Mercy College in four sets in Colonial States Athletic Conference action on Thursday night. The Pacers move to 12-6 on the year including a 5-2 conference mark while the Griffins record slides to 5-18 (3-3 CSAC).
Marywood take the first game in a convincing, 25-8 fashion before Gwynedd-Mercy leveled with a 25-21 decision in the second set. The Pacers would seal the victory though with wins of 25-11 and 25-22 in the third and fourth frames, respectively.
The Pacers got kills from eight different players, led by nine from Emily Fillman (Clarion, PA). Alyssa Hartranft (Mountain Top, PA) had a match-best 26 assists to go along with seven service aces, matching the Pacers' single-game high on the year. Rachel Tollett (Elkins Park, PA) collected 14 digs for Marywood.
The Griffins' got a match-high 18 kills from Rachel Lambert and 22 assists from Maria Stilwell in the loss.
